— Because Jeff Hardy has three felonies on his record now, he may not be able to get into all countries or get a working Visa. R-Truth has had this problem because of his felony, and that one was over twenty years ago. WWE has passed on hiring people for having felonies before, though none of them had Jeff’s name value.
— Kurt Angle’s 0.091 blood alcohol test done at the scene of his arrest on Saturday will not be admissible in court. However, he did fail field sobriety tests and he could get a DUI for being unable to pass those tests even if the BAC was below the limit.
